About this movie

Brad Pitt takes no prisoners in Quentin Tarantino's high-octane WWII revenge fantasy Inglourious Basterds. As war rages in Europe, a Nazi-scalping squad of American soldiers, known to their enemy as 'The Basterds,' is on a daring mission to take down the leaders of the Third Reich. The catastrophically self-indulgent Kill Bill led a lot of us to write Tarantino off, or at least assume his best days were behind him. And then along came Basterds, a flawed, beautiful lump of a film whose bucket load of pin-perfect scenes presaged greater things to come. Most exciting of all is the possibility that with Django, Tarantino hasn't even hit his stride yet.
